CIVICUS, Feb 28, 2012 Dr Leila Alieva, President of the Center for National and International Studies (CNIS) in Baku, Azerbaijan, spoke to CIVICUS recently about the deteriorating civil society environment in her country and what international civil society can do to assist colleagues in Azerbaijan. Dr Alieva has published extensively on issues of security, conflict and politics in Central Asia, and has long years of experience as a civil society activist. Otherwise, we will soon become the epicenter of imperial conflict.” Tensions rise on the Armenia- Azerbaijan border On September 12, the ceasefire was again violated on the Azerbaijan-Armenia border. On Tuesday, Armenian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an said that 49 Armenian soldiers were killed during clashes on the border with Azerbaijan. At least 71 Azerbaijani soldiers were killed, according to the official statement released on Thursday. Both Armenia and Azerbaijan accused each...
